5.3 Mounting
Follow these steps to mount the UX360 to the
wall. See Figures 2 and 3.
1. Turn OFF all power to heating and cooling
equipment.
2. Route the wires through the opening on the
Sub-base.
3. Place the Sub-base against the wall in the
desired location and mark the wall through
the center of each mounting hole.
4. Drill the holes in the wall where marked.
5. Mount the Sub-base to the wall using
included mounting screws and drywall
anchors. Make sure all wires extend through
the Sub-base.

5.4 Wiring
1. Adjust the length and position of each wire to
reach the proper terminal on the connector
block of the Sub-base. Strip 1/4” of insulation
from each wire. Do not allow adjacent
wires to short together when connected. If
stranded thermostat cable is used, one or
more strands will have to be cut to allow
the cable to fit connector. For use with solid
conductor 18 ga. thermostat wire.
2. Match and connect control wires to the
proper terminals on the connector block.
Refer to the Field Wiring Connection
Diagrams shown later in this document.
3. Push excess wire back into the wall and seal
the hole to prevent air leaks.
NOTE: Air Leaks in the wall behind the
UX360 can cause improper operation.
4. Attach the UX360 to the Sub-base.
5. Turn ON power to the heating and cooling
equipment.
